Drake State vs. Reid State Technical College Cost Comparison
Which college is more expensive, Drake State or Reid State Technical College? Published tuition is the sticker price; many students pay less after aid (see average net price below).
- The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at Reid State Technical College than Drake State ($2,288 vs. $6,075).
-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at Reid State Technical College are 23.8% lower than at J. F. Drake State Community and Technical College ($7,200 vs. $9,450).
- Reid State Technical College is 5.1% more expensive for in-state tuition than Drake State (about $264 more per year; $5,454.00 vs. $5,190.00).
- Out-of-state tuition is 2.9% higher at Reid State Technical College than at J. F. Drake State Community and Technical College (about $264 more per year; $9,324.00 vs. $9,060.00).
- A larger share of students receive grant aid at Reid State Technical College than at J. F. Drake State Community and Technical College (97% vs. 84%).
- The average total grant financial aid received by Reid State Technical College students is 21.2% larger than aid received by J. F. Drake State Community and Technical College students ($9,991 vs. $8,245).
